scsi: lpfc: Fix issues connecting with nvme initiator

In the lpfc discovery engine, when as a nvme target, where the driver
was performing mailbox io with the adapter for port login when a NVME
PRLI is received from the host. Rather than queue and eventually get
back to sending a response after the mailbox traffic, the driver
rejected the io with an error response.

Turns out this particular initiator didn't like the rejection values
(unable to process command/command in progress) so it never attempted a
retry of the PRLI. Thus the host never established nvme connectivity
with the lpfc target.

By changing the rejection values (to Logical Busy/nothing more), the
initiator accepted the response and would retry the PRLI, resulting in
nvme connectivity.
